On tap at the brewery.
Nice solid black stout appearance with a frothy cap of head. Spicy aroma, cinnamon and allspice. Sweet snickerdoodle taste, lots of spice--nutmeg, cinnamon, allspice, ginger--with a strong dark malt body. Prickly spice mouthfeel, almost like chewing Big Red. Not quite full bodied, but with everything that was going on, the mouthfeel was nice. I really liked this one.
